THE BURNING SEASON: a biography of Chico Mendes, a Brazilian rubber tapper and homegrown environmentalist who was killed in December 1988 by ranchers intent on ravaging the jungle for short term gain. It is also a celebration of the beauty of the rain forest and a plea for its preservation.
